      Navigating China’s VAT Invoice System: A Guide for Foreign Business Owners

      As a foreign business owner operating in or trading with China, understanding the local invoicing system is crucial for compliance and financial health. Unlike in many Western countries where invoices are primarily commercial documents, in China, the Fapiao (發(fā)票) is a legal and fiscal document controlled by the State Taxation Administration (STA).


      One of the most common points of confusion is the distinction between the two main types of VAT invoices and how they affect your bottom line. If you are dealing with a client who is a General Taxpayer (一般納稅人) , you might be wondering: Can I issue them a Regular VAT invoice? And if so, how does the tax work?


      Here is a breakdown of what you need to know.



      1. The Two Faces of VAT: Special vs. Regular

      China’s VAT system categorizes invoices into two primary types. The key difference is not the tax rate, but the eligibility for VAT tax deduction.

      2. Can I Issue a Regular Fapiao to a General VAT Taxpayer Client?

      Yes, absolutely. However, there is a strategic consideration: If you issue a General Fapiao instead of a Special Fapiao, your client cannot use it to claim a tax deduction.  This makes your product or service more expensive for them in terms of net cash flow.

      For example, if your product costs ¥10,600 (including 6% VAT), a regular Fapiao forces your client to record the full ¥10,600 as an expense. A Special Fapiao allows them to record ¥10,000 as an expense and claim the ¥600 as a tax credit to offset against their own sales tax liability.



      3. When would a General VAT Taxpayer issue a Regular Fapiao?

      There are specific scenarios where a Special Fapiao cannot be issued, including:

      1) Sales to Non-general VAT taxpayers or individuals (consumers).

      2) A company that is a general VAT taxpayer but does not require a Special VAT Fapiao.

      3) Sales of tax-exempt items.

      4) Certain transactions deemed non-deductible by the STA (e.g., certain entertainment or personal consumption goods).
